Natalie Wood (born July 20, 1938 - death November 29, 1981) was a Russian-American actress who began her career in film as a child and became a Hollywood star as a young adult. She began acting in films at age 4 and was given a co-starring role at age 8 in Miracle on 34th Street (1947). [23] After she started acting as a child, RKO executives David Lewis and William Goetz changed her surname to "Wood" to make it more appealing to English-speaking audiences and as a tribute to filmmaker Sam Wood. During the 1970s, Wood began a hiatus from film and had two daughters: one with her second husband Richard Gregson, and one with Robert Wagner, her first husband whom she married again after divorcing Gregson.
